Red Sox News
In a season defined by disappointment, the Boston Red Sox eked out a 5-3 victory over the Baltimore Orioles, yet the lingering frustration around the team persists. Jarren Duran's inability to find his footing only highlights the missed opportunities in trades, leaving fans to question the front office’s judgment. Meanwhile, former pitcher Cooper Criswell’s breakout with the Mariners serves as a painful reminder of what could have been for Boston's beleaguered bullpen. The team also saw Ranger Suarez dominate with eight scoreless innings in a recent outing against Toronto, showcasing the caliber of pitching they desperately need. Amidst all this, a shake-up in the coaching staff is underway, hinting at a desperate attempt to salvage the season. With an 11-17 record, the Red Sox need to turn things around fast, or risk falling further behind.
